42/*
43 * ISA Bus conventions
44 */
45
46/*
47 * Input / Output Port Assignments
48 */
49#ifndef IO_ISABEGIN
50#define IO_ISABEGIN 0x000 /* 0x000 - Beginning of I/O Registers */
51
52 /* CPU Board */
53#define IO_DMA1 0x000 /* 8237A DMA Controller #1 */
54#define IO_ICU1 0x020 /* 8259A Interrupt Controller #1 */
55#define IO_PMP1 0x026 /* 82347 Power Management Peripheral */
56#define IO_TIMER1 0x040 /* 8253 Timer #1 */
57#define IO_TIMER2 0x048 /* 8253 Timer #2 */
58#define IO_KBD 0x060 /* 8042 Keyboard */
59#define IO_PPI 0x061 /* Programmable Peripheral Interface */
60#define IO_RTC 0x070 /* RTC */
61#define IO_NMI IO_RTC /* NMI Control */
62#define IO_DMAPG 0x080 /* DMA Page Registers */
63#define IO_ICU2 0x0A0 /* 8259A Interrupt Controller #2 */
64#define IO_DMA2 0x0C0 /* 8237A DMA Controller #2 */
65#define IO_NPX 0x0F0 /* Numeric Coprocessor */

135/*
136 * Input / Output Port Sizes - these are from several sources, and tend
137 * to be the larger of what was found.
138 */
139#ifndef IO_ISASIZES
140#define IO_ISASIZES
141
142#define IO_ASCSIZE 5 /* AmiScan GI1904-based hand scanner */
143#define IO_CGASIZE 12 /* CGA controllers */
144#define IO_COMSIZE 8 /* 8250, 16x50 com controllers */
145#define IO_DMASIZE 16 /* 8237 DMA controllers */
146#define IO_DPGSIZE 32 /* 74LS612 DMA page registers */
147#define IO_EISASIZE 256 /* EISA controllers */
148#define IO_FDCSIZE 8 /* Nec765 floppy controllers */
149#define IO_GAMSIZE 16 /* AT compatible game controllers */
150#define IO_GSCSIZE 8 /* GeniScan GS-4500G hand scanner */
151#define IO_ICUSIZE 16 /* 8259A interrupt controllers */
152#define IO_KBDSIZE 16 /* 8042 Keyboard controllers */
